Officials from the South African Revenue Service (SARS) intercepted a male passenger who was in possession of a 5kg cocaine package with a street value of approximately R1.4-million at OR Tambo International Airport yesterday.

Initially the traveller indicated he had no luggage.

Through further questioning the traveller admitted to be the owner of a bag that was allegedly handed to him in Sao Paolo.

A thorough search and scan of the luggage that included the use of a detector dog found three smaller bags that contained cocaine.

The traveller and the cocaine were handed over to SAPS for further investigation and possible prosecution.
